TWeaK ( @TWeaK@lemm.ee ) English6•1 year agoIt contains 31 CSV files, including evert comment, post, everything. Except which alt accounts they think you also have. There’s one for any Twitter accounts you’ve linked, and it has files for everything you’ve voted on.
The real benefit of getting it is you can use the post and comment CSV files with the github version of shreddit (the website version charges you $15) and actually delete everything. PowerDeleteSuite only gets the content on your profile, under New, Hot, Top & Controversial, where each list is limited in size - old comments with lower karma will be excluded.
Also reddit has been restoring deleted content. This may be to do with how reddit CDN servers work, rather than something intentional, but it’s scummy regardless. You have to do it over several days to make sure you get everything.
